Coffee Cake with Caramel and Cream Topping
Ingredients
Cake
- 375 ml cake flour
- 1 ml salt
- 10 ml baking powder
- 60 ml milk
- 60 ml water
- 15 ml instant coffee
- 30 ml butter
- 4 eggs
- 250 ml sugar
- 5 ml vanilla essence
Coffee Syrup
- 375 ml water
- 170 ml sugar
- 5 ml vanilla essence
- 25 ml instant coffee
- 50 ml brandy
Topping
- 1 tin of caramel
- 1 packet of caramel instant pudding
- 250 ml milk
- 250 ml fresh cream
Method
Cake
-
Preheat the oven to 180° Celsius
-
Sift the cake flour, baking powder and salt together and keep aside
-
Heat the milk, water, instant coffee and butter together and keep aside
-
Beat the eggs, sugar and vanilla together
-
Fold the flour mixture into the egg mixture
-
Add the heated mixture to this, little by little
-
Mix well and bake for about 30 minutes until a skewer comes out clean
-
Skip the cake syrup part for now and move over to the topping so the instant caramel pudding can set while the cake are baking, then afterwards move over to the cake syrup
Cake Syrup
-
Add all the syrup ingredients in a sauce pan and cook together for 5 minutes
-
Prick the cake with a kebab stick all over for the syrup to be absorbed and pour the syrup slowly little by little until used up
Topping
-
Start with the caramel and cover(spread) the cake with the smooth caramel(whisk the caramel with an electric beater to smooth en it)
-
The cake must be cooled when starting this step
-
Beat the milk and the caramel instant pudding and let it set in fridge
-
Whisk the cream until stiff and fold into the caramel instant pudding
-
Spread this over the caramel layer
-
Garnish with grated chocolate or raspberries
